Software to panelize PCB

Posted by

What is PCB Panelization?

PCB panelization involves taking individual PCB designs and arranging them into a larger multi-PCB panel. This panel is what actually gets manufactured, allowing many copies of a PCB to be produced at once rather than individually.

The process of panelization includes:

  1. Importing the individual PCB designs
  2. Arranging the designs into an optimized panel layout
  3. Adding tooling holes, breakaway tabs, and other panel features
  4. Generating manufacturing files for the final panel design

Proper panelization is important to ensure high manufacturing yields and minimize wasted material. The panel needs to be designed to withstand the rigors of the assembly process.

Benefits of Using Panelization Software

Panelization can be done manually, but specialized software makes the process much easier and provides several key benefits:

  • Quickly import and arrange multiple PCB designs
  • Automatically optimize panel layouts to maximize PCB per panel
  • Easily add tooling holes, Mouse Bites, breakaway tabs and other panel features
  • Catch design issues early before manufacturing
  • Generate manufacturing files in industry standard formats
  • Streamline communication between design and manufacturing teams

Using panelization software helps ensure the final panel is optimized and ready for a smooth manufacturing process, reducing costs and time to market.

Types of Panelization Software

There are a few different types of software used for PCB panelization:

Software Type Description
Standalone Panelization Tools Dedicated software packages that specialize in panelization. Examples include CAM350, DFM Now, and PanelBuilder
PCB Design Software with Panelization Many PCB design tools like Altium Designer, Eagle, and KiCad have built-in or add-on panelization capabilities
Pre-Production CAM Tools Panelization is sometimes handled in CAM (Computer-Aided Manufacturing) software by the manufacturer after receiving design files

The choice of panelization software depends on a company’s existing design tools, complexity of panelization needed, and personal preference.

Features to Look for in Panelization Software

When evaluating PCB panelization software, some key features to look for include:

  1. Ease of importing PCB designs in standard formats
  2. Automatic and manual panel layout tools
  3. Design rule checks to catch issues
  4. Support for mixed PCB sizes, shapes and thickness in a single panel
  5. Ability to add fiducials, tooling holes, and other panel elements
  6. Good documentation and customer support
  7. Compatibility with your other design tools and manufacturing partners

More advanced panelization needs may require specialized features like those for flexible circuits, RF designs, or Metal-Core PCBs. Ensure the software you choose supports your technical requirements.

Panelization Best Practices

Following some best practices helps ensure reliable, high-quality panel designs:

  • Consult with your manufacturer early on their panelization capabilities and guidelines
  • Use a robust method like V-groove or perforated break-away tabs to depanelize individual PCBs without damage
  • Carefully choose the type, size and location of tooling holes, fiducials and other panel elements
  • Allow space between boards for component overhangs, soldermask pullback, and manufacturing tolerances
  • Follow good panel design rules for minimum spacing, trace width, aspect ratios, etc.
  • Validate panelized designs with your manufacturer before beginning production

Panelization Challenges and Solutions

Even with the help of panelization software, designers can run into challenges like:

Challenge Solution
Individual PCBs with irregular shapes that are hard to panel efficiently Get creative with tab patterns and panel layouts to maximize PCB per panel
Fragile PCB substrates that are prone to damage when depanelizing Use methods like V-groove slots instead of rough break-away tabs
Mixed PCB Thicknesses that require special considerations in assembly Work closely with your manufacturer to accommodate steps in the panel
Keeping track of different revisions of a design across a panel Implement a clear PCB version numbering scheme and include it on the panel

Open communication with your manufacturing partner and careful planning during the design process can alleviate most panelization issues.

Popular PCB Panelization Software

Some of the most popular choices for PCB panelization software include:

  1. Altium Designer – PCB design software with panelization capabilities
  2. CAM350 – Dedicated PCB CAM and panelization tool from DownStream Technologies
  3. EAGLE – PCB design software from Autodesk with panelization features
  4. GerberLogix – Standalone Gerber editing and panelization program
  5. PCB Panelizer – Low-cost, easy to use panelization tool for small businesses and hobbyists

The right choice depends on your budget, technical needs, and compatibility with existing tools and workflows.

How to Get Started with PCB Panelization Software

To get started using PCB panelization software, follow these basic steps:

  1. Evaluate your panelization needs and choose appropriate software
  2. Install and set up the software, including any libraries and configuration files
  3. Gather the individual PCB design files you wish to panelize
  4. Create a new panel project and import the PCB designs
  5. Arrange the PCBs into an optimized panel layout
  6. Add any needed tooling holes, fiducials, or other panel elements
  7. Run design rule checks and correct any errors
  8. Export manufacturing files like Gerbers, NC drill files, etc.
  9. Send the panelized design to your manufacturer for prototyping and production

FAQs

What is the difference between a PCB array and a PCB panel?

A PCB array typically refers to identical PCBs laid out in a grid, while a panel is a more general term that can include arrays and also mixed PCB designs laid out to maximize a manufacturing panel.

Do I need to panelize my PCBs?

Panelization is not required for all PCBs but is very common, especially for smaller boards and higher production volumes. Consult with your manufacturer on whether your design should be panelized.

Can I panelize flex PCBs?

Yes, flex PCBs can be panelized but require special considerations compared to rigid PCBs. Panelization software with specific features for flex circuits is recommended.

Why are there mouse bites on my PCB panel?

Mouse bites are a type of perforated break-away tab used to hold the individual PCBs into the panel securely during assembly but allow them to be easily separated after.

What if I don’t have room on my PCB for break-away tabs?

In cases where the PCB design can’t accommodate tabs, an alternative method like V-groove slots or adding waste material can be used. Work with your manufacturer to choose the best depanelization method.

Conclusion

PCB panelization is a crucial step in electronics manufacturing that benefits from specialized software. Panelization tools make it easier to create optimized panels ready for production, while following best practices ensures high yields and minimal issues during assembly.

With a wide range of panelization software options available, from standalone tools to integrated features in PCB design programs, there is a solution to fit every need and budget. Properly panelizing your PCB designs with the help of capable software will save time, reduce costs, and ensure a smooth transition from design to mass production.

Leave a Reply

Your email address will not be published. Required fields are marked *